The Sudden Rise of Homo sapiens

One of the most unsettling questions in human history is why our species, Homo sapiens, suddenly became so dominant. Fossils and genetic evidence suggest that for a long stretch, we were just one clever ape among several, sharing the planet with Neanderthals, Denisovans, and maybe others we have barely glimpsed in DNA. Then, in what looks like a relatively short flash of time on evolutionary scales, our kind spread across continents, created complex cultures, and pushed everyone else to the margins – or to extinction.

Researchers argue over what triggered that leap. Some point to a gradual build-up of cognitive abilities that finally crossed a tipping point, while others see cultural innovations – like more sophisticated language, teaching, or symbolic thinking – as the real accelerator. From the outside, it is tempting to imagine a single “switch” being flipped in the human brain, but the evidence reads more like a patchwork: changing climates, shifting food sources, social cooperation, and plain old luck. The mystery is not just how we got smarter, but why we turned out to be the branch that survived when so many others did not.

What Really Happened to the Neanderthals?

Neanderthals used to be the punchline of human evolution, portrayed as slow, clumsy cave dwellers. That cartoon image has collapsed. We now know they made tools, used fire skillfully, likely cared for injured group members, and may have created symbolic objects. Genetic studies show that most people with ancestry outside Africa still carry a bit of Neanderthal DNA, meaning our ancestors did not just compete with them – they also had children together.

Yet even with all that nuance, the core question remains: why are Neanderthals gone and we are not? Climate swings probably hit them hard, especially in Europe and western Asia, and competition with expanding Homo sapiens groups would have made life tougher. But “climate plus competition” is more of a loose outline than a satisfying explanation. Were they outnumbered, out-innovated, or just unlucky in a series of bad centuries? The fact that part of them literally lives on in our genomes makes their disappearance feel less like a clean ending and more like a story that was absorbed into ours, with crucial pages missing.

The Mystery of the Denisovans

If Neanderthals feel like long-lost cousins, Denisovans are more like shadow relatives we barely know. Discovered through a few bones and teeth in a Siberian cave and identified by their unique DNA, they turned out to be a distinct group of ancient humans who left a genetic imprint across parts of Asia and Oceania. Some present-day populations in places like Tibet and Melanesia carry notable Denisovan ancestry, including gene variants that seem to help with high-altitude living.

The weird part is how little we actually see of them in the physical record. We have genomes, but barely any skeletons. We have genetic hints of multiple Denisovan populations, but almost no clear idea of where they lived, what they looked like in full, or how they organized their societies. It is like finding a thumb drive full of family photos from someone you have never met, without ever seeing their house or hearing their voice. Until more sites are uncovered, the Denisovans will remain one of the most tantalizing ghosts in our own family tree.

The True Age of Human Culture

When did humans first start behaving “like us” – telling stories, making art, sharing rituals? Archaeologists often point to symbolic objects, cave paintings, ornaments, and musical instruments as signs of fully modern minds. Some of the earliest known examples of this kind of creativity stretch back tens of thousands of years, with carved figures, decorated tools, and astonishing rock art in places such as Europe, Africa, Asia, and Australia. Each new find seems to push the timeline for complex culture a little further into the past.

The trouble is that culture does not fossilize neatly. A bead or a painted wall can survive, but a myth told around a fire or a dance honoring the dead usually cannot. That makes it hard to know whether we are seeing the true beginning of symbolic thought or just the earliest traces that happened to endure. There is a growing sense that our ancestors may have been thinking and communicating in rich, abstract ways long before the surviving artifacts suggest. The gap between what must have been happening in their minds and what we can actually see in the ground is one of the most frustrating and fascinating gaps in human history.

The Purpose of Megalithic Monuments

From Stonehenge to the aligned stones of Brittany, from vast stone circles in Africa to ceremonial sites in the Americas, people across different continents raised enormous blocks of rock using muscle, ingenuity, and staggering amounts of time. Many of these megalithic structures line up with the movements of the sun, moon, or stars, hinting at ancient skywatchers carefully tracking the heavens. Others are linked with burials or communal gathering spaces, turning the landscape itself into a kind of sacred architecture.

Yet we still argue about their main purpose. Were they calendars, temples, power symbols, or social glue binding communities together through shared labor? Maybe they were all of those things at once. What we can say is that building them required cooperation on a scale that reshaped early societies. Lost Civilizations or Missing Context?

Every few months, a headline or video pops up hinting that advanced civilizations might have risen and fallen thousands of years earlier than mainstream archaeology accepts. Massive earthworks, submerged ruins, and surprisingly complex artifacts make some people wonder whether an earlier chapter of human history has been wiped almost clean, leaving only confusing fragments behind. It is an appealing idea: a forgotten global culture erased by catastrophe, hiding in plain sight.

Most researchers push back hard on the most dramatic versions of that story, pointing out that impressive construction and organization do not automatically mean high technology or global empires. Often, better dating methods and more careful excavation show that structures fit into known timelines of regional cultures. Still, there are cases where dating is difficult or evidence is thin, and honest uncertainty remains. The tension here is between healthy skepticism and open-minded curiosity: how do we respect the work of decades while also admitting that some pieces genuinely do not fit yet?

The Enigma of Human Language Origins

Language is probably the single most powerful tool humans ever evolved, yet we have no physical fossil of its starting point. Vocal cords and tongues do not preserve the way bones do, and early speech left no written traces. At some point, our ancestors went from basic calls and gestures to rich, layered languages that could carry stories, instructions, gossip, and abstract ideas. That transition might be the biggest leap in human cognition, but no one can pin down when it truly happened.

Different theories try to fill that void. Some imagine language emerging gradually as social groups grew more complex, needing better ways to coordinate and share knowledge. Others suggest a relatively quick shift, perhaps tied to changes in the brain or vocal tract. We can compare modern languages, study how children learn to speak, and look for clues in brain anatomy, yet the first true conversations are lost forever. Why Did We Start Burying Our Dead?

At some point, humans began treating their dead in ways that went far beyond basic disposal. We see graves with carefully arranged bodies, grave goods like tools or ornaments, and signs that people returned to burial sites over time. There are even older hints that other human species, such as Neanderthals, may have engaged in some kind of intentional treatment of the dead, though interpretations there are controversial. Whatever the exact timeline, the shift from simply leaving a body to deliberately burying it marks a profound change in how we saw one another.

Was this about hygiene, predator control, and practicality, or was it about belief, grief, and memory? The presence of objects and repeated rituals points strongly toward emotional and symbolic motives. It suggests our ancestors were grappling with questions of identity, continuity, and what might lie beyond life. The Origins of Agriculture and Settled Life

Farming looks like an obvious upgrade from hunting and gathering, but the archaeological record tells a more complicated story. Early agricultural communities often worked harder, faced new diseases, and ate less varied diets than their foraging neighbors. So why did so many groups across different regions eventually settle into farming and village life? In the so-called Fertile Crescent, in parts of China, in Mesoamerica, and elsewhere, people began domesticating plants and animals within overlapping but not identical time frames.

Some explanations focus on climate shifts making wild foods less predictable, nudging groups toward managed crops. Others emphasize social and political factors: farming can support larger populations, store wealth, and allow elites to emerge. There is a strong chance that different regions followed slightly different paths, mixing environmental pressure with cultural choices. The mystery is not simply how we learned to plant seeds, but why we collectively decided that staying put, building permanent communities, and shouldering all the new problems that came with them was worth it.

The Deep Genetic Shadows in Our DNA

As genetic technology has improved, scientists have started finding faint traces of ancient humans in our DNA that do not clearly match any known fossil group. These so-called “ghost lineages” hint that we may have interbred with multiple populations that have left little or no physical trace behind. The Denisovans were essentially discovered through this kind of genetic detective work, and there may be more hidden branches of humanity waiting to be identified in the code we all carry.

This raises a radical possibility: the number of distinct human groups that once walked the Earth could be higher than anything we have confidently named so far. It also makes our neat diagrams of human evolution look far too simple, with one tidy trunk and a few obvious branches. Instead, the picture emerging is more like a tangled forest of populations splitting, merging, and sometimes disappearing almost without a trace.
